Output e39bd2e49efc98c2fa658f5430a4bdbb62d7e53840baa89657932566ca321988:12

value
37933159
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4d427121bf5f860ade3c296bdf54e52234158ea2 OP_EQUALVERIFY OP_CHECKSIG
address
183WdEinXaxK6PnUje15qe6cPFGZbvzJht
transaction
e39bd2e49efc98c2fa658f5430a4bdbb62d7e53840baa89657932566ca321988
spent
true